ADDIE (Analysis Design Development Implementation). The ADDIE model is an acronym: Analysis, Design, Development, Implementation, and Evaluation. It’s a five-phase framework that instructional designers use; a guideline for building effective training and learning support tools. AuthoringTool. Customer Training.

Open source software: Software for which the source code is publicly available for use and development free of charge. Moodle is an example of open source software that’s used widely in specific kinds of eLearning environments, like universities. What is training tracking software? Training tracking software is a specialized type of software designed to help organizations track the progress of their participants through the training programs they offer and the broader management of their training programs. ADDIE: An acronym made up of the words: Analysis, Design, Development, Implementation, and Evaluation. AICC (Aviation Industry Computer-Based-Training Committee): The first official eLearning content standard, AICC was developed by the Aviation Industry CBT Committee in 1993 as a CD-ROM based standard.

Articulate Storyline, a rapid authoringtool from the Articulate team has a user-friendly interface. Articulate Storyline publishes into SCORM, TIN CAN and AICC which helps in tracking of courses and managing the database when uploaded into any Learning Management System.
